Recall Details

Company:
Abbott Point Of Care Inc.
Reason for Recall:
Abbott Point of Care has determined that some individual patient results generated with the i-STAT G3+ cartridge lot N13183 have the potential to exhibit incorrectly elevated PCO2 and depressed pH results.
Classification:
Class I - Dangerous

Dangerous or defective products that predictably could cause serious health problems or death.
